Understanding the Squid Game
The Squid Game is a fictional South Korean survival game that was introduced in the Netflix series of the same name. The game is played by 456 contestants who are in dire need of money to save their families from debt. The Impact of the Squid Game on Society
The Squid Game has sparked a global conversation about poverty, debt, and the desperation that drives people to take extreme measures to improve their lives. The game’s portrayal of contestants who are willing to risk their lives for money has raised awareness about the struggles that many people face in the real world.
